Manual Therapy Exerts Local Anti-Inflammatory Effects Through Neutrophil Clearance
Conclusion: MT can mitigate localized inflammation induced by injured skeletal muscle, achieved by decreasing S100A9 protein expression and clearing neutrophils in mice, which may help advance therapeutic strategies for skeletal muscle localized inflammation.
